Job description

My client is looking for a Project Manager to provide technical project support for the sales efforts of the company. This role is critical in retaining profitability and finding ways to avoid risk throughout a project. Project managers are accountable for ensuring the overall success of a project’s installation. It’s also critically important for the Project Manager to possess strong customer service skills and be a strong communicator.

Responsibilities and Duties:

  • Pre-order
  • Communicate the project scope and requirements with the Operations Manager and/or installation companies. Request labor quotes from the installation companies.
  • Perform site visits to confirm site infrastructure, details, and requirements and communicate with the team.
  • Review proposed product applications and communicate in project team meeting findings to ensure proper functionality.
  • Assist in the preliminary and final tagging of the product lines in Kham.
  • Review approved design development downloads from design.
  • Post-order
  • Review preliminary and final core plans from design as required.
  • Lead and coordinate pre-install meetings with all parties involved
  • Schedule installations with the clients or GC’s and communicate to the team.
  • Communicate and ensure the installation companies’ compliance with all safety training, badging, and other project requirements.
  • Receive PlanGrid file from PC and upload necessary files as the project progresses.
  • Manage and coordinate all manufacture deliveries at site with the installation companies.
  • Continually review the product shipment status, LTL’s, shortages, and delays from manufacturers and communicate to the team.
  • Perform preliminary punch list walkthrough with installation companies to remedy all on-site issues prior to formal punch with client.
  • Perform formal punch list walkthrough with client and communicate with PC all product issues required to be rectified.
  • Perform site visits as required, identifying any short shipments, damages, wrong product, and communicate to PC’s for service notification submittals to the manufacturers.
  • Ongoing
  • Communicate effectively with customer and internal team throughout project
  • Responsible for creating and maintaining strong working relationships with installation and product vendors.
  • Attend weekly status report meetings to review active projects with the team.
  • Attend client and GC meetings as required and communicate to team the project status.
  • Obtain COI’s from installation companies and forward copies to finance.
  • Review weekly backlogs and send invoicing requests to finance for product and service invoicing.
  • Other duties as assigned.
